Before to the COVID-19 pandemic, in the United States, suicide was the 10th highest cause of death overall, and the 2nd … WebHuman papillomavirus infection (HPV infection) is caused by a DNA virus from the Papillomaviridae family. Many HPV infections cause no symptoms and 90% resolve spontaneously within two years. In some cases, an HPV infection persists and results in either warts or precancerous lesions. WebOct 27, 2024 · The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) does not recommend regular testing to diagnose genital warts. Pap smears are used to screen for the cancer-causing strains of HPV. Regular testing for HPV in women is recommended to screen for cervical cancer and other complications of HPV.
